Lesson: Angle Measures and Segment Lengths in Circles Unit 9: Circles Lesson: Angle Measures and Segment Lengths in Circles Essential Questions: How are the angles and arcs in a circle related? How can you find the measure of angles, arcs, & chords when lines intersect a circle?

Circles Goals: To find the measures of inscribed angles. To find the measure of angles formed by a tangents, secants, and chords. To find the length of segments associated with circles. Essential Understandings: Angles and the arcs formed have a special relationship. There is a special relationship between intersecting chords, secants and tangents.
